Looking at configuration data, 56% of decommissioned routers disposed of and sold on the secondary market contained sensitive corporate data, according to ESET. Of the networks that had complete configuration data available: 22% contained customer data 33% exposed data allowing third-party connections to the network 44% had credentials for connecting to other networks as a trusted party 89% itemized connection details for specific applications 89% contained router-to-router authentication keys 100% contained one or more of … More
